Held Health Limited is seeking an experienced clinician to join its CAMHS service, delivering neurodevelopmental diagnostic assessments for children and young people across ADHD and autism pathways. The role involves structured interviews, reviewing developmental histories, school reports, and informant questionnaires, with remote and in-person delivery depending on pathway requirements and clinical need; flexible and governance-aligned practice.
